It's the textiest time of the year. The time for those who love interactive fiction (or text adventures) to gather around monitors, play, discuss and judge the latest Interactive Fiction Competition entries. The 2015 IF Comp, you see, has opened its gates and everyone is invited to partake in the many joys and exquisite pleasures of text based gaming. Of parsers and CYOAs.
The full list of the more than 50 games can be found here (many of them are also playable online) and a handy archive of all the games can be downloaded by following the direct link to a truly brilliant zip archive.
As for me, well, I've only scratched the surface, but can so far suggest clever '50s sci-fi horror Brain Guzzlers from Beyond!, brilliant dungeon crawler TOMBs of Reschette, puzzle box Grandma Bethlinda's Variety Box and the beautifully illustrated Capsule II.
